web-dev-qa-db-ja.com

これら2つのフォームレイアウトのどちらが優れているか(より「マテリアル」)

以下に示す2つのフォームレイアウトを検討してください

ここでのコンテキストはAndroidアプリターゲットAndroid v 4.4+です。コントロールは

  1. 平らにしようとしたセレクトボックス
  2. タップするとサーキュラーセレクター付きのポップアップダイアログを表示する読み取り専用の入力
  3. ユーザー名

私には「間違っている」と思われるもの

  • 少なくとも下のボーダーがないと、l.h.s。選択ボックスのように見えない/感じない
  • 年齢ラベル+ l.h.sの入力を感じます。大画面にうまく対応していません

私がここでいくつかの洞察を提供できるよりも多くのUX経験を持つ誰かに願っています。

6
DroidOS

あなたの観察は正しいと思います! select-box および text-field の標準の相互作用パターンを確認してください

現在のレイアウトに基づいて、次のいずれかを選択することをお勧めします。

enter image description here


OR

enter image description here

11
DPS

Age入力が何らかのドロップダウンまたはピッカーを開いている場合は、ドロップダウン矢印を使用することをお勧めします。それ以外の場合は、ユーザーがテキストを入力することになっているテキスト入力のように見えます。

ユーザーが性別を選択した場合、ユーザーが選択ボックスのオプションにこのオプションがあるというヒントがないため、性別の選択ボックスには「私は性別を開示したくない」を含めません。

gender default に関するコメントを@AdrianMaireに感謝します。

5
Alvaro